web-dev-qa-db-ja.com

Amazon Linux 2 AMI-AWS-Amazon Linux 2にMySQLをインストールする方法

MysqlをAmazon linux 2 AMIにインストールしようとしていますが、実行できません。

Sudo yum install mysql56-server -> doesn't work
Amazon-linux-extras list -> doesn't list mysql

Mysqlへの露出が多いため、mariadbは必要ありません(両方が同じであっても)

15
Jey Geethan

自分で答えがわかりました。以下の手順に従ってください:

Sudo wget https://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m
Sudo yum localinstall mysql57-community-release-el7-11.noarch.rpm 
Sudo yum install mysql-community-server
systemctl start mysqld.service

重要なのは、Amazon Linux 2にはデフォルトのリポジトリがまだ用意されていないため、ソースリポジトリを追加してからインストールすることです。

17
Jey Geethan

Amazonの documentation は、MariaDB(MySQLのフォーク)の使用を推奨しているようです。インストールするには:

Sudo yum -y install mariadb-server
Sudo service mariadb start
4
Jonathan